summ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orajacoutot <ajacoutot@openbsd.org>2009-08-17 12:02:47 +0000
committerajacoutot <ajacoutot@openbsd.org>2009-08-17 12:02:47 +0000
commitc412dc89a1e659c0d3889afaa90edf98e1bb790f (patch)
tree9a95b240df05de5526e503a353c91edbfe7ebd77
parentalso report routers and their host states in relayctl (diff)
downloadwireguard-openbsd-c412dc89a1e659c0d3889afaa90edf98e1bb790f.tar.xz
wireguard-openbsd-c412dc89a1e659c0d3889afaa90edf98e1bb790f.zip
Don't try to move files that don't exist.
-rw-r--r--usr.sbin/sysmerge/sysmerge.sh6
1 files changed, 4 insertions, 2 deletions
diff --git a/usr.sbin/sysmerge/sysmerge.sh b/usr.sbin/sysmerge/sysmerge.sh
index 03c174eae91..6048714525f 100644
--- a/usr.sbin/sysmerge/sysmerge.sh
+++ b/usr.sbin/sysmerge/sysmerge.sh
@@ -1,6 +1,6 @@
#!/bin/sh -
#
-# $OpenBSD: sysmerge.sh,v 1.48 2009/08/16 20:15:10 ajacoutot Exp $
+# $OpenBSD: sysmerge.sh,v 1.49 2009/08/17 12:02:47 ajacoutot Exp $
#
# Copyright (c) 1998-2003 Douglas Barton <DougB@FreeBSD.org>
# Copyright (c) 2008, 2009 Antoine Jacoutot <ajacoutot@openbsd.org>
@@ -40,7 +40,9 @@ clean_src() {
restore_bak() {
for i in ${DESTDIR}/${DBDIR}/.*.bak; do
_i=`basename ${i} .bak`
- mv ${i} ${DESTDIR}/${DBDIR}/${_i#.}
+ if [ -f "${i}" ]; then
+ mv ${i} ${DESTDIR}/${DBDIR}/${_i#.}
+ fi
done
}